Best of 14 picnic spots in Phoenix

Picnic spots in Phoenix offer a variety of options for outdoor dining and activities. From the scenic views of South Mountain Park and Preserve to the lush greenery of Encanto Park, there are plenty of choices for a perfect picnic. Other notable locations include Phoenix Mountains Preserve, Papago Park, and Granada Park, each providing unique features for a memorable experience.
